DIVINE INSTRUCTION – THE ANTIDOTE TO IGNORANCE
Scripture Focus: John 14:26; 2 Timothy 3:16–17; Ephesians 4:11–13
The only force powerful enough to break the grip of ignorance is divine instruction—truth revealed by God and taught through His chosen vessels. Ignorance is not removed by emotion or experience; it is removed by instruction birthed from revelation. God's chosen method for building His people is through teaching, training, and spiritual enlightenment by His Spirit and His Word.
The Role of the Holy Spirit as Teacher
Jesus introduced the Holy Spirit in John 14:26 with these words:
“But the Comforter, which is the Holy Ghost… he shall teach you all things, and bring all things to your remembrance, whatsoever I have said unto you.”
The Holy Spirit is not just a power to be felt—He is a Teacher to be listened to. He reveals what human minds cannot perceive and what education cannot explain. When He teaches:
• Mysteries are unlocked
• Scriptures become alive
• Divine strategies are released
• Personal convictions are established
He teaches not only by revelation but also through remembrance—He brings back to your spirit what you’ve read or heard from God’s Word at the exact moment it is needed. This is why Spirit-filled believers cannot afford to neglect fellowship with the Holy Spirit.
The Holy Spirit gives:
• Clarity where there is confusion
• Depth where there is shallowness
• Conviction where there is compromise
Without the Holy Spirit as Teacher, one may become lettered in Scripture but void of power (2 Corinthians 3:6).
The Word of God – The Ultimate Source of Truth
2 Timothy 3:16–17 says:
“All Scripture is given by inspiration of God, and is profitable for doctrine, for reproof, for correction, for instruction in righteousness…”
The Scriptures are not merely historical texts; they are divinely inspired manuals for victorious living. The Word of God is:
• The sword of the Spirit (Ephesians 6:17)
• A lamp to our feet and a light to our path (Psalm 119:105)
• The seed of transformation (Luke 8:11)
Any believer who neglects the Word will remain spiritually malnourished and vulnerable. It is the ultimate measuring rod for all revelation, dreams, visions, or teachings. Without the Word:
• Experiences become deceptive
• Emotions replace truth
• Human wisdom overtakes divine counsel
The Word is non-negotiable in the school of divine instruction. It is the curriculum of the Spirit’s teaching ministry.
Apostolic and Prophetic Teaching in the End-Time Church
In this age of increased deception and spiritual dilution, God is restoring apostolic and prophetic teaching—ministries that do not just excite the church, but equip and mature the saints.
Ephesians 4:11–13 reminds us:
“And He gave some, apostles; and some, prophets; and some, evangelists; and some, pastors and teachers… for the perfecting of the saints…”
The apostolic ministry lays foundation (doctrine, order, and structure), while the prophetic ministry brings revelation and alignment to God’s present purposes.
These ministries, when rooted in the Word and governed by the Spirit, confront ignorance in the Body of Christ. They:
• Expose false doctrines
• Unveil God’s plans and timing
• Empower believers to walk in truth, not just excitement
In these last days, God is raising a church that is both deep in Word and rich in revelation. The combination of Spirit-led teaching and biblically grounded instruction is the formula for a victorious, mature church.
